Dumpster Size Option



When choosing a dumpster size, take into consideration the quantity of waste you need to dispose of and the room readily available on your building. It's essential to precisely estimate the amount of debris you'll be throwing out to guarantee you choose a dumpster that can fit all of it. If dumpster renting select a dimension that's also tiny, you might wind up requiring numerous trips to the landfill or added pick-ups, bring about added costs and aggravation.

On the other hand, picking a dumpster that's too big for your needs can be a waste of money and valuable area on your property.

To determine the right size, take stock of the kind and amount of products you'll be taking care of. For small cleanouts or restorations, a 10-yard dumpster might be enough. For larger jobs like whole-home cleanouts or building and construction, you may require a 20 or 30-yard dumpster. Citizen Regulations Understanding



To make certain a smooth dumpster rental experience, it's important to be aware of neighborhood policies controling garbage disposal in your location. Various cities and regions have certain regulations relating to where and how dumpsters can be placed, what products are allowed to be taken care of, and the required permits for placing a dumpster on your home or the street. Failure to abide by these regulations can lead to fines or other penalties, so it's vital to acquaint yourself with the neighborhood needs prior to reserving a dumpster.



Some areas might have constraints on the sorts of materials that can be gotten rid of in a dumpster, such as hazardous waste or electronic devices. Additionally, there may be standards on the placement of the dumpster, such as distance from property lines or guaranteeing it does not obstruct traffic or accessibility to emergency situation solutions. Comprehending these guidelines beforehand will help you stay clear of any type of issues throughout your rental duration and guarantee an easy experience.

Make certain to check with your regional waste monitoring authority or city officials to obtain a clear understanding of the regulations that put on your area.

Garbage Disposal Guidelines



Prior to you start dealing with waste in the leased dumpster, it's critical to follow details guidelines to make sure correct and effective disposal.

Be mindful of any unsafe products that are banned from being discarded in the dumpster, such as chemicals, batteries, or electronics. These things call for special disposal methods to prevent damage to the environment and public health.

Additionally, prevent overfilling the dumpster beyond its ability restriction, as this can position security dangers during transport.

Comprehend the weight restricts established by the rental business and avoid surpassing them to avoid extra costs or problems.
